There are many ways to deploy Vue.js. One of the more common ways is to use the Apache server to deploy Vue.js projects. Next, we will introduce how to deploy the Vue.js project on the Apache server.

1. Install the Apache server

First, we need to install the Apache server. On the Ubuntu operating system, you can install it through the following command:

s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get install apache2

2. Package the Vue.js project

Enter the Vue.js project path and use the following command to package the project:

npm run build

After executing this command, a dist folder will be generated under the project, which contains the files we need to deploy.

3. Create an Apache virtual host

Before deploying the Vue.js project, we need to create an Apache virtual host. On the Ubuntu operating system, the configuration file of the Apache virtual host is located in the /etc/apache2/sites-available directory.

Create a virtual host configuration file, for example:

sudo nano /etc/apache2/sites-available/vue.conf

Add the following content in the file:

<VirtualHost *:80>
    # 端口号可以更改
    ServerName yoursite.com
    # 域名或者IP地址
    DocumentRoot /var/www/vue
    # Vue.js项目打包文件夹的路径
    <Directory /var/www/vue>
        Options -Indexes
        AllowOverride All
        Order allow,deny
        allow from all
        Require all granted
    </Directory>
    ErrorLog /var/log/apache2/vue_error.log
    CustomLog /var/log/apache2/vue_access.log combined
</VirtualHost>

Among them, ServerName fill in the domain name or IP address , DocumentRoot item fills in the path of the Vue.js project packaging folder.

After saving the file, execute the following command to make the modifications effective:

sudo a2ensite vue.conf

Then, restart the Apache server:

sudo service apache2 restart

4. Deploy the Vue.js project

Copy the dist folder obtained after packaging the Vue.js project to the DocumentRoot path in the Apache virtual host configuration.

In order to ensure that the Apache server can load these files normally, we need to add a base tag to the index.html file to specify the directory in which the HTML file is located. For example:

<head>
    <meta charset="utf-8">
    <meta name="viewport" content="width=device-width, initial-scale=1">
    <title>Vue App</title>
    <base href="/">
    <!-- 其他依赖资源 -->
</head>

After saving the modifications, we can access the Vue.js project by accessing the domain name or IP address of the virtual host.
